Picking the Right Paint and Equipment



Wondering which repaint and tools are best for your indoor paint project? When it concerns picking the ideal paint, consider variables like the sort of surface you're painting, the preferred coating, and the color options offered. For walls, a latex paint is commonly the most effective choice because of its durability, simple clean-up, and fast drying out time. If you're painting a high-traffic area like a hallway or cooking area, a semi-gloss or satin surface may be more suitable as they're less complicated to clean.



As for devices, buying top quality brushes and rollers can make a considerable distinction in the last outcome of your paint task. Look for brushes with dense bristles that appropriate for the type of paint you're using. Roller covers come in various nap dimensions, with much shorter naps being perfect for smooth surfaces like wall surfaces and ceilings, while longer snoozes are better for textured surfaces.

Preparing Your Space for Painting



To ensure a successful indoor painting task, proper preparation of your room is critical. Begin by getting rid of furniture from the area or relocate to the center and covering it with plastic sheets. Next, take down any decorations, change plates, and electrical outlet covers. Use painter's tape to shield baseboards, trim, and any type of locations you don't wish to paint. Fill openings and fractures in the wall surfaces with spackling substance, after that sand them smooth when dry. Dirt and clean the wall surfaces to make sure proper paint adhesion.

After preparing the walls, put down drop cloths to secure your floorings. If you're painting the ceiling, cover the whole floor location with ground cloth, securing them in place with painter's tape. Guarantee appropriate air flow by opening home windows or utilizing followers to aid with drying and to lessen the fumes. Last but not least, gather all your painting supplies in one location to have every little thing you need accessible. Making the effort to prepare your area will make the paint procedure smoother and help you attain an expert coating.
